  • Historic Centre of Quito: Stroll through one of the best preserved historic centres in Latin America, declared a UNESCO World Heritage Site. Discover colonial churches, charming squares and fascinating museums.
  • The Society of Jesus: Admire the impressive baroque church of La Compañía de Jesús, famous for its rich gold leaf interior decoration and colonial architecture.
  • Plaza de la Independencia: Also known as Plaza Grande, this is the political and social heart of Quito. Here you will find the Carondelet Palace, the Metropolitan Cathedral and the Archbishop's Palace.
  • Basilica del Voto Nacional: Visit this monumental neo-gothic church, one of the largest in the Americas. Climb its towers for spectacular panoramic views of the city.
  • El Panecillo: Climb this iconic hill offering breathtaking views of Quito and the famous statue of the Virgin of Quito. A perfect spot for panoramic photographs.
  • Museo Casa de Sucre: Learn about the life and work of Mariscal Antonio José de Sucre at this museum located in a colonial house that belonged to the independence hero.
  • Calle La Ronda: Stroll along this picturesque cobblestone street, lined with craft shops, art galleries, restaurants and traditional cafes. It is an ideal place to experience the local culture.
  • Quito Cable Car: Take the cable car up the Pichincha Volcano and enjoy spectacular views of Quito from above. Ideal for hikers and nature lovers.
  • Guangüiltagua Metropolitan Park: Enjoy a day outdoors in Quito's largest urban park, perfect for walks, picnics and bird watching.
